Hard-Cast vs JHP vs SWC: Which Type Wins?

Hard-cast bullets are the workhorses of the 44 Magnum world. These lead alloy projectiles feature a flat or wide meplat (nose) that creates devastating wound channels through deep penetration, making them ideal for hunting tough game like wild hogs, black bears, and deer. The harder alloy (typically 92-6-2 or similar with a Brinell hardness of 18-22) resists deformation and maintains trajectory even through heavy bone and muscle.

Jacketed hollow points (JHP) expand reliably at 44 Magnum velocities, creating wider temporary wound cavities than hard-cast options. Modern designs like the Speer Gold Dot and Hornady XTP feature bonded cores or thick jackets that prevent over-expansion and jacket separation at magnum speeds. The Sierra Sports Master is another proven option specifically engineered for this dual defense/hunting role – its Power Jacket thick copper construction controls expansion across the full 44 Magnum velocity range, from defensive loads at 1,200 fps through full hunting loads at 1,400+ fps. These bullets work best for self-defense scenarios or medium game hunting where maximum tissue damage within the first 12-18 inches matters more than extreme penetration.

For shooters who prefer a pure defensive design rather than a dual-purpose bullet, the Sierra V-Crown (available in .429-inch) uses V-shaped skives for velocity-independent expansion – useful when handload velocities vary more than factory ammunition would. The Federal Trophy Bonded and Nosler Partition are further bonded/partitioned options worth sourcing as components if available, both providing reliable weight retention through bone at magnum velocities.

Semi-wadcutter (SWC) bullets bridge the gap between target and field use. The sharp shoulder cuts clean holes in paper targets for easy scoring, while the flat nose still delivers respectable terminal performance on small to medium game. Cast SWC bullets are economical for high-volume practice shooting and can be loaded to mild velocities that reduce recoil while maintaining accuracy.

For lead-free hunting where regulations require it (California condor zone and similar), the Cutting Edge HG Raptor provides a 6-blade fragmenting solid copper option, while the Cutting Edge HG Solid offers a non-expanding solid copper penetrator comparable in role to hard-cast but without lead. The Lehigh Defense Wide Flat Nose and Lehigh Defense Maximum Expansion round out the lead-free options in .429-inch for handloaders who need compliant ammunition.

For hunting large or dangerous game, hard-cast or the Cutting Edge HG Solid wins for penetration. For defense against two-legged threats, a quality JHP like the Sports Master or V-Crown offers faster incapacitation. For target work and plinking, cast SWC bullets save money without sacrificing accuracy. Many serious 44 Magnum shooters keep all three types on hand and select based on the day’s mission.


Top 240gr and 300gr Bullets for 44 Magnum

The 240gr weight class represents the traditional 44 Magnum standard and offers the best balance of velocity, energy, and manageable recoil. Hornady’s 240gr XTP features a swaged lead core with a thick copper jacket designed to expand at velocities from 1,000 to 1,400 fps without fragmenting. Speer’s 240gr Gold Dot uses a bonded core construction that keeps the jacket and lead together even after hitting heavy bone, making it a top choice for whitetail deer hunting. The Sierra Sports Master 240gr is the direct Sierra equivalent, with SD 0.186 providing solid penetration for deer-sized game from a revolver.

For cast bullet shooters, quality 240gr SWC designs from established cast bullet makers deliver excellent accuracy at velocities up to 1,200 fps. These typically use a harder alloy than softer target bullets, reducing lead fouling in the barrel while maintaining the weight for good sectional density and penetration.

Heavy 300gr bullets turn the 44 Magnum into a serious big-game cartridge capable of taking elk, moose, and even dangerous game with proper shot placement. Quality 300gr hard-cast designs feature a wide flat nose (often 65-70% of bullet diameter) that crushes tissue and bone while driving deep. These bullets typically need a 1:20 or faster rifling twist to stabilize properly, which most 44 Magnum firearms provide.

Hornady offers a 300gr XTP-MAG specifically designed for magnum handgun cartridges, featuring a thicker jacket than the standard XTP to handle the increased pressure and velocity. This bullet performs best in the 1,100-1,250 fps range from a revolver, where it expands to approximately 0.60-0.65 inch while retaining 95%+ of its weight. For lever-action rifles with 18-20 inch barrels that push velocities to 1,400+ fps, hard-cast bullets typically outperform JHPs due to better weight retention and penetration.

Best Hard-Cast Bullets for Hunting Big Game

When hunting animals that can hurt you back or tough game requiring deep penetration, hard-cast bullets with a wide flat nose are the proven choice. The flat meplat crushes a permanent wound channel through tissue rather than pushing it aside like a round-nose design. Look for bullets with at least a 60% meplat ratio (the flat nose measures 60% or more of the bullet’s diameter) for maximum tissue destruction.

Alloy hardness matters significantly for performance. Softer cast bullets (Brinell hardness 10-12) work fine for target loads but can deform or lead the barrel at full-power hunting velocities. Quality hunting cast bullets use alloys like Lyman #2 (95-5-0 lead-tin-antimony) or harder commercial blends that test at 18-22 BHN. These harder bullets maintain their shape through bone impacts and resist leading even at velocities exceeding 1,300 fps.

Popular hard-cast designs include the 300gr wide flat nose (WFN) profile and the 280gr long flat nose (LFN) profile available from various cast bullet manufacturers. These bullets often feature a gas check (a copper cup crimped to the base) that protects the bullet base from hot powder gases and allows higher velocities without leading. The gas check also helps maintain accuracy by preventing base deformation.

For black bear, wild hogs, or deer-sized game, a 280-300gr hard-cast at 1,200-1,300 fps from a revolver provides more than adequate penetration. If you’re loading for a lever-action rifle, velocities can reach 1,500+ fps with the right powders, turning the 44 Magnum into a legitimate 100-yard hunting rifle. Always verify your specific bullet design feeds reliably in your rifle before heading to the field.

For handloaders shooting from a longer lever-action barrel where the 44 Magnum genuinely competes with smaller rifle cartridges in terms of energy delivery, the velocity increase over a revolver barrel (typically 150-250 fps with the same load) shifts the optimal bullet selection slightly. A bullet that performs perfectly at 1,250 fps from a 4-inch revolver barrel may behave differently at 1,500 fps from an 18-inch rifle barrel – this is exactly the scenario where hard-cast’s velocity-insensitive penetration has a real advantage over jacketed designs optimized for revolver-only velocity ranges.

For hunters needing lead-free hard-cast alternatives, the Cutting Edge HG Solid provides comparable deep-penetration performance (40+ inch gel penetration in testing) using solid copper rather than lead alloy, at the cost of higher per-round expense.


How Bullet Shape Affects Lever-Action Feeding

Lever-action rifles chambered in 44 Magnum like the Marlin 1894 and Henry Big Boy have tubular magazines where cartridges sit nose-to-primer. Bullet shape directly impacts feeding reliability and safety in these firearms, making profile selection critical for trouble-free operation.

Flat-nose and round-nose bullets feed most reliably through lever-action tubular magazines. The flat nose prevents the bullet from contacting the primer of the cartridge ahead of it under recoil, eliminating the risk of chain-fire detonation. Round-nose designs also work but offer less terminal performance than flat-nose bullets of the same weight. Avoid sharp-pointed bullets entirely in tubular magazines – they create a genuine safety hazard.

For handloaders who want the aerodynamic and expansion advantages of a polymer-tipped bullet without the tubular magazine safety risk, Hornady’s Flex Tip technology solves this problem directly. The Hornady MonoFlex (lead-free, monolithic gilding metal) and Hornady LeverEvolution (lead-core) both use a soft, compressible polymer tip that deforms safely under magazine recoil pressure while still initiating reliable expansion on impact at velocities as low as 800 fps. The MonoFlex’s 200-grain .429-inch entry is specifically built for 44 Magnum lever rifles and is the California-compliant choice; the LeverEvolution provides the same tube-safety advantage at lower cost where lead-free compliance isn’t required.

Semi-wadcutter bullets can cause feeding issues in some lever-actions due to their sharp shoulder catching on the magazine tube or carrier. If you want to use SWC bullets in your rifle, test them thoroughly before relying on them. Some rifles feed them perfectly, while others jam consistently. The crimp groove location also matters – bullets with crimp grooves too far forward may require excessive overall cartridge length that won’t fit the magazine.

Jacketed hollow points require careful selection for lever-action use. Choose designs with a relatively flat or rounded ogive rather than sharp, pointed profiles. The Hornady XTP and Speer Gold Dot both work well in most 44 Magnum lever rifles because their nose profiles are blunt enough to feed reliably. Always test-cycle at least 20 rounds through your specific rifle before trusting any bullet design in the field.

Quick Checklist for Lever-Action Bullet Selection

  • Flat-nose or round-nose profiles only – no pointed bullets unless using Flex Tip designs (MonoFlex / LeverEvolution)
  • Overall cartridge length must fit magazine (typically 1.610 inches max)
  • Test-cycle at least 20 dummy rounds through your specific rifle
  • Verify crimp groove allows proper case mouth engagement
  • Hard-cast bullets should have rounded nose edges, not sharp corners
  • Check that bullet diameter matches your bore (.429 or .430 inch)

Common Mistakes When Choosing 44 Magnum Bullets

Using the wrong bullet diameter is surprisingly common and kills accuracy. Most 44 Magnum firearms have a groove diameter of either .429 or .430 inch, with older revolvers often running slightly larger. Jacketed bullets typically measure .429 inch and work in both bore sizes, but cast bullets should match your specific bore. Slugging your barrel (pushing a soft lead slug through to measure) takes five minutes and prevents accuracy problems.

Pushing cast bullets too fast causes leading, accuracy loss, and poor terminal performance. Even hard-cast bullets have velocity limits before gas blow-by and base deformation occur. Most cast bullet makers recommend keeping velocities under 1,300 fps unless using gas-checked designs specifically rated for magnum velocities. If you see leading in your bore, you’re either going too fast or your alloy is too soft.

Choosing bullets based solely on weight ignores critical factors like construction, intended velocity range, and terminal performance goals. A 240gr bullet could be a soft-swaged lead target bullet, a bonded JHP, or a hard-cast hunting design – all perform completely differently. Match the bullet construction to your intended use and velocity range rather than just grabbing the heaviest or lightest option available.

Ignoring crimp groove placement leads to improper overall cartridge length and poor case mouth engagement. The crimp groove indicates where the manufacturer designed the bullet to be crimped – using a different location can cause excessive pressure, poor accuracy, or bullets pulling forward under recoil. This especially matters in revolvers where heavy recoil can unseat bullets in unfired rounds still in the cylinder. A firm roll crimp at the cannelure is essential for 44 Magnum loads, both for this reason and to ensure consistent powder ignition.

Over-expanding JHPs at rifle velocities happens when you use revolver-optimized bullets in a lever-action. A JHP designed to expand properly at 1,200 fps from a revolver may fragment or over-expand at 1,500+ fps from a 20-inch rifle barrel. For rifle use at higher velocities, hard-cast bullets typically provide better penetration and terminal performance than JHPs designed for handgun velocities – this is precisely the niche the Flex Tip MonoFlex and LeverEvolution were designed to fill, since their 800 fps expansion threshold and controlled-expansion construction tolerate the velocity range from revolver to rifle better than conventional JHPs.


Primers and Powder for 44 Magnum

Magnum-rated primers are standard practice for full-power 44 Magnum loads, particularly with slower-burning powders that require more reliable ignition. CCI 350 magnum large pistol and Federal 215 magnum large rifle (used by some handloaders in heavily compressed 44 Magnum rifle loads) are the standard choices.

For powder selection, Alliant 2400 and Hodgdon H110 are the classic 44 Magnum hunting powders, delivering full-velocity performance with both 240gr and 300gr bullets. Alliant Power Pistol and Alliant Blue Dot are faster-burning alternatives better suited to lighter defensive loads at moderate velocities. Hodgdon Trail Boss deserves mention for reduced-recoil cast bullet target loads – it fills a large portion of case volume at low charge weights, making double-charge errors visually obvious and producing very mild-shooting practice ammunition with cast SWC bullets. FAQ: 44 Magnum Bullet Selection and Sizing

What’s the difference between .429-inch and .430-inch diameter bullets?

The difference is only 0.001 inch, but it matters for accuracy. Most modern 44 Magnum firearms have .429-inch groove diameters and shoot .429-inch bullets best. Older revolvers, particularly some Ruger models, may have .430-inch bores and perform better with slightly oversized cast bullets. Jacketed bullets at .429-inch work in both. Slug your barrel if accuracy is poor with properly loaded ammunition.

Can I use 44 Special bullets in 44 Magnum loads?

Yes, but verify the bullet is rated for magnum velocities. The 44 Special and 44 Magnum share the same .429-inch bullet diameter – the cartridges differ in case length and pressure, not bullet specification. Many 44 Special bullets are designed for lower pressures and velocities around 900-1,000 fps. Pushing a soft-swaged target bullet to 1,300+ fps can cause leading, jacket separation, or poor terminal performance. Check the manufacturer’s velocity recommendations before loading any bullet to full magnum pressures. Do I need gas-checked bullets for full-power loads?

Gas checks help but aren’t always mandatory. Plain-base cast bullets can handle velocities up to about 1,200-1,300 fps with proper hard alloys and sizing. Above those velocities, gas-checked bullets resist leading better and maintain accuracy by protecting the bullet base from hot powder gases. For maximum-pressure hunting loads, gas checks provide an extra safety margin against leading.

How much does bullet shape affect accuracy?

Bullet shape matters less than proper sizing, alloy hardness, and consistent manufacturing. A well-made round-nose, flat-nose, or SWC bullet will all shoot accurately if properly sized to your bore and loaded correctly. Bullet length and bearing surface area affect accuracy more than nose profile. Longer bullets with more bearing surface typically require slightly faster twist rates to stabilize but often shoot more accurately once stabilized.

Should I use plated bullets for 44 Magnum?

Plated bullets work well for light to moderate 44 Magnum loads but have velocity limitations. Most plated bullet manufacturers recommend keeping velocities under 1,200-1,300 fps to prevent plating separation. They’re an excellent middle-ground option between cast and jacketed bullets for practice loads, offering cleaner shooting than plain lead without the cost of jacketed bullets. Avoid using them for full-power hunting loads.

What’s the best all-around bullet for someone just starting to reload 44 Magnum?

Start with a quality 240gr jacketed hollow point like the Hornady XTP, Speer Gold Dot, or Sierra Sports Master. These bullets are forgiving to load, work across a wide velocity range (1,000-1,400 fps), feed reliably in revolvers and lever-actions, and perform well for defense, hunting medium game, and practice. Once you’ve mastered loading and shooting these, branch out to cast bullets for economical practice or heavy hard-cast for serious hunting.
